    THE INVENTORS SONY MOBILE COMMUNICATION AB Sony Mobile Communications AB (formerly Sony Ericsson Mobile Communications AB) is a multinational mobile phone manufacturing company headquartered in London‚ United Kingdom and a wholly owned subsidiary of Sony Corporation. It was founded on October 1‚ 2001 as a joint venture between Sony and the Swedish telecommunications company Ericsson. Sony acquired Ericsson’s share in the venture on February 16‚ 2012. Sony Mobile Communications AB (formerly Sony Ericsson Mobile Communications AB) is a multinational mobile phone manufacturing company headquartered in Tokyo‚ Japan‚ and a wholly owned subsidiary of Sony Corporation. On October 27‚ 2011‚ Sony announced that it would acquire Ericsson’s stake in Sony Ericsson for €1.05 billion ($1.47 billion)‚ making the mobile handset business a wholly owned subsidiary of Sony.     1. Introduction 1.1 Background Sony Ericsson was found in 2001 as a joint venture owned in equal parts by the Sony Corporation and Ericsson AB. The mother company‚ Sony Ericsson Mobile Communications AB‚ is registered in Sweden where also its headquarters are. Since it dominates the market with a market share of around 45%‚ Sony Ericsson is the market leader in Sweden in the mobile phones sector in 2007.
